Saw a working cut back in June 2014 and this was my review back then...

If you read the synopsis of this on imdb, you will have a fair idea of how the whole film unfolds. No surprises for the demographics this is squarely aimed at then: Jewish; weed comedy connoisseurs; undemanding Britcom watchers. The next question is whether the script feels convincing or real enough and if not, whether the acting is charming enough to make you forget (and forgive) its flaws. Sadly, after a promising and steady start, the film unravels soon around the mid-way point and contrivances mount on top of contrivances. Pyrce and Collins are good and watchable ? proving the experienced luvvies? worth. But it is a broad film: not really a comedy nor as dramatic as it wants to be. The subject matters (East End regeneration; drug trafficking with toothless and unthreatening gangstars; family business drama; gerrys on weed having a laugh?) feel familiar and while the Jewish/Muslim dynamic does give it a little oomph, it is not enough to carry the film through. A pretty typical Britcom then: harmless but a bit all over the place ultimately.
